Output 63deb13810575a39a09b2975071375630402fa3eb70229502fa45ce65bc904e1:0

value
2807958
script pubkey
OP_0 OP_PUSHBYTES_20 581ecad7800a958ee92307939271b9a8fc9013e9
address
bc1qtq0v44uqp22ca6frq7feyude4r7fqylfahkjaq
transaction
63deb13810575a39a09b2975071375630402fa3eb70229502fa45ce65bc904e1
spent
true